PISD Nominated For Susan G. Komen Co-Survivor Award

December 18, 2009

The staff and students of Petersburg ISD are deeply honored and humbled to be nominated for the Susan G. Komen Co-Survivor Award because of their participation in Nancy Horn’s journey of the past few years.  PISD truly appreciates all that Komen Lubbock has done not only for Nancy, but for all those affected by breast cancer.  As a way to further honor both Nancy and this wonderful organization, a group (ALL of Petersburg ISD!!!) picture was taken this past Friday.  

 

Ashley Hamm, Executive Director, Susan G. Komen for the Cure, Lubbock Affiliate explains the reasons behind the nomination.

 

 

"The Lubbock Area affiliate of Susan G. Komen for the Cure is asked to nominate volunteers and activist who make a real difference in the lives of our community.  The Komen Board of Directors selected Petersburg ISD for the Co-Survivor Award nominee because of the compassion and support shown to Nancy Horn during her breast cancer journey and thereafter.  Komen Lubbock if forever grateful for the support of groups such as Petersburg ISD.  Please know that you play a vital part in helping breast cancer patients fight this terrible disease and your support is a huge part of their success.  Thank you for your dedication to Nancy and to this cause!"
